About

This app provides a personalized, offline platform for cardists to track and practice their moves. Users can build custom libraries, organize routines, and monitor progress with detailed stats and practice modes. It focuses on a do-it-yourself approach to training, ensuring a deeply personal journey.

Build custom move library
Organize moves with categories
Practice with routine modes
Hands-free voice controls
Track streaks and consistency
Monitor progress with stats
Data export and import

What's New in Charlier

2.5

April 7, 2026

This update adds automatic day/night theme switching, a YouTube tutorial search button in Move Detail, and custom page sorting for Home and Practice. It also introduces new Daily Stats and Weekly Stats widgets on Home with charts, preview video, and tap-through support for your most-practiced move, plus expanded Dan and Dave Buck author autofill coverage. It also fixes notification greetings so they read more naturally with your display name, and resolves a bug where a move’s main video could freeze after finishing a move-to-count session from that move’s detail page.

What is Charlier?

Charlier is a personal, offline cardistry tracker designed to help you build and practice your own move library. It focuses on a do-it-yourself approach to training, allowing you to organize and monitor your progress in a way that reflects your unique journey.

Can I use Charlier offline?

Yes, Charlier is built as an offline application. Everything stays on your device, and no account is required, ensuring your data remains private and accessible without an internet connection.

How does Charlier help me practice?

Charlier offers multiple session styles, including Regular Routine and Move to 100 for repitition-focused training. It also supports hands-free voice controls in certain modes, allowing you to maintain flow during practice sessions.

Does Charlier track my progress?

Yes, Charlier provides detailed progress tracking. You can monitor XP growth, mastery changes, move statistics, skip trends, and heatmaps to understand what is improving and what needs more work.
